Coming from a non-musical background in the Healthcare Field this self taught Musical Engineer, Producer and Female Disc Jockey have always had a thing for great sound and music production since the age of 22. Born in Washington D.C, “Queen” began hanging out with local producers and artist in her area providing them with her knowledge and skills that she has learned while recording, editing, mixing, and mastering. Courtney- further mastered the art of music production by putting in long nights and hours with a friend who goes by the name of “Chop Beatz” Mr. Beatz who is a well known Drummer of a local GO-GO Band and a young rising Producer helped this Queen to develop a great understanding of extensive technical detail of recording equipment, engineering, and acoustics. In 2016 Courtney put her knowledge and skill of mixing and mastering behind studio doors to the test further earning her name “Queen of the Turntables” often showcasing her amazing beats, using percussion breaks, baselines and other musical content sampled from pre-existing records that she herself has worked on and other Hip-Hop music from various genres and artist as well. Often sought out after finishing her sets by local artist and producers Courtney “Queen of the Turntables” earned her well needed respect and recognition for preparing and educating the youth about music, entrepreneurship and the importance of education.
Courtney has been a disc jockey and a public speaker at local youth and women empowerment events in her area such as We Are Phenomenal Young Women a nonprofit organization that inspires young women to be their best while learning the necessary skills to become a leaders and The Women Group a organization dedicated to women all across the globe nationally and internationally. Courtney- is always on the move educating others while perfecting her craft as a Music Producer and a female Disc Jockey, in February 2017 she became the Dj for a weekly internet show segment titled: Black Gold Radio this segment airs every other Sunday from 3:30-5pm EST providing a platform for indie-music, fashion and small business owners she also commits herself to future projects like owning her own recording studio and music school. What inspired me to enter the music industry was the Gender Diversity and how when it comes to a women’s ability to contribute and lead we have been shut out of the process for years. this made me want to be a part of changing that dynamic. What advice would you share with readers interested in a similar pursuit? What I would share with readers is this, be confident in what you plan to pursuit being a Female Disc Jockey is all in what you make it. you either sink or swim the choice is yours. What challenges do women DJ's face most? Being a Full Figured DJ has its challenges I’ve been rejected from performing at events just because of my size. In reality for the club scene most promoters want a perfect Betty and I’m pretty satisfied with not fitting that bill.
